[Nix-dev] Installation of evince fails
Yury G. Kudryashov
urkud.urkud at gmail.com
Mon Apr 2 07:19:59 CEST 2012
Ilja Honkonen wrote:
>>>> Installation of evince fails currently for me with:
>>> The problem is in gnome-doc-utils. It uses wrapPythonPrograms but lacks
>>> pythonPath. I'll fix it tonight.
>> What I did to find the source of the bug:
>> - In build log, xml2po fails to load libxml2Python.
>> - xml2po comes from gnome.gnome_doc_utils. Build this package
>> - Open $gnome_doc_utils/bin/xml2po in editor. Look at PYTHONPATH.
>> - No /nix/store/*libxml2* here. (!!)
>> - Look at gnome_doc_utils_derivation, go to pythonPackages.wrapPython,
>> read sources.
>
> Thanks! Now it works, although it prints this when starting:
> GLib-GIO-Message: Using the 'memory' GSettings backend. Your settings
> will not be saved or shared with other applications.
Try to install GConf. Not sure if it helps. Probably, you'll need gsettings-
desktop-schemas as well.
P.S.: Feel free to package dconf and submit a patch.
--
Yury G. Kudryashov,
mailto: urkud at mccme.ru
More information about the nix-dev
mailing list